Lextel is a modern invented name combining elements suggestive of 'lex' (Latin for law or word) and a suffix '-tel' evoking light or brightness. It implies a guardian or bearer of law, light, or wisdom. Although not rooted in ancient tradition, it draws from classical Latin and modern creativity to symbolize strength, intelligence, and illumination.
Though Lextel is a modern creation, it resonates culturally by echoing ancient Latin roots and contemporary naming trends favoring unique yet meaningful names. Its association with law, light, and wisdom makes it appealing in societies valuing knowledge and leadership. It reflects a blend of classical influence and modern individuality.
Lextel fits well within the current trend of distinctive, inventive baby names that combine traditional elements with fresh sounds. It offers parents a unique yet accessible name choice, balancing familiarity through its Latin-inspired structure with originality. Its rarity means it stands out without being difficult to pronounce or spell.
